Transaction e50d73fb8ae084d4dea5be83d2da722d96dc21f5e364f0022b32810da5425af8
2 Input
1 Outputs
- e50d73fb8ae084d4dea5be83d2da722d96dc21f5e364f0022b32810da5425af8:0
value 84167954
address 3BMEXSsfCxbrVvBZdazdBLYzWf5C3Hm2sk